In the kidney, gluconeogenesis takes place within the proximal tubule cells. Much of the glucose produced is consumed by the renal medulla, while the kidney’s function in sustaining blood glucose turns into more outstanding during extended fasting or liver failure. Unlike the liver, the kidney lacks vital glycogen shops and contributes to glucose homeostasis only by gluconeogenesis, not glycogenolysis. Only elements of the gluconeogenesis pathway are active in skeletal muscle, cardiac muscle, and the brain, and at very low rates. However, these tissues can't launch free glucose into the bloodstream because they lack glucose 6-phosphatase (EC 3.1.3.9), the enzyme chargeable for the final step of gluconeogenesis. In consequence, glucose 6-phosphate (G6P) produced, both through gluconeogenesis or glycogenolysis, stays trapped in the cell and is used just for inside energy wants or glycogen resynthesis. Within the mind, this happens mainly in astrocytes. The one direct contribution of these tissues to blood glucose upkeep, significantly skeletal muscle, attributable to its massive mass (roughly 18 occasions that of the liver), comes from the restricted release of free glucose by way of the debranching enzyme (EC 3.2.1.33) throughout glycogenolysis.
